From b91bb296188118eea9fdc6093cfcf76bbe8589ba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Dan Williams Date: Thu, 17 Nov 2011 17:59:52 -0800 Subject: [PATCH] [SCSI] libsas: use ->set_dmamode to notify lldds of NCQ parameters sas_discover_sata() notifies lldds of sata devices twice. Once to allow the 'identify' to be sent, and a second time to allow aic94xx (the only libsas driver that cares about sata_dev.identify) to setup NCQ parameters before the device becomes known to the midlayer. Replace this double notification and intervening 'identify' with an explicit ->lldd_ata_set_dmamode notification. With this change all ata internal commands are issued by libata, so we no longer need sas_issue_ata_cmd(). The data from the identify command only needs to be cached in one location so ata_device.id replaces domain_device.sata_dev.identify.
